What is Prenatal Yoga?
Prenatal yoga is a specialized practice designed to support pregnant women throughout their pregnancy journey. It combines physical postures, breathing techniques, and mindfulness, promoting relaxation and strength while preparing the body for childbirth.

Benefits of Practicing Prenatal Yoga
Engaging in prenatal yoga can provide several advantages for expectant mothers:
- Improved Flexibility: Helps prepare your body for childbirth.
- Stress Relief: Reduces anxiety and promotes relaxation.
- Better Sleep: Enhances sleep quality through relaxation techniques.
- Strengthened Muscles: Builds strength in key muscle groups needed for labor.
- Enhanced Bonding: Encourages connection with your baby through mindfulness.
Practical Tips for Starting Prenatal Yoga Online
Here are some practical tips to get started with prenatal yoga online:
- Consult Your Doctor: Always check with your healthcare provider before starting any new exercise regimen.
- Choose the Right Class: Select classes that cater to your trimester and skill level.
- Create a Comfortable Space: Designate a quiet area in your home for practice.
- Invest in Comfort: Use a good yoga mat and wear comfortable clothing.
- Stay Hydrated: Keep water nearby to stay hydrated during your practice.

Common Concerns About Prenatal Yoga
Expectant mothers often have questions or concerns when it comes to prenatal yoga. Here are some common queries:
- Is prenatal yoga safe for all trimesters? Yes, as long as you follow appropriate guidelines and choose suitable classes.
- Can I do yoga if I have never practiced before? Absolutely! Many online classes cater specifically to beginners.
- What if I feel discomfort during practice? Listen to your body; modify poses as needed or take breaks when necessary.
